What zip code has the Highest Poverty Level Among Families in Mission, TX?
78574 has the Highest Poverty Level Among Families in Mission, TX with 29.9%.
What is the Poverty Level Among Families in Mission, TX?
Poverty Level Among Families in Mission is 18.4%.
What is the Poverty Level Among Families in Texas?
Poverty Level Among Families in Texas is 10.7%.
What is the Poverty Level Among Families in the United States?
Poverty Level Among Families in the United States is 8.8%.
